CDNX
Announces Market Activity for First Six Months of 2000
|
|
Six Months Results
The Canadian Venture Exchange (CDNX) today
announced strong market performance for the six months ending June 30, 2000. The CDNX
Index closed the period at 3458.67, up 48% from its closing level on January 4. The new
exchanges sector indices posted even higher gains over the six months with the
technology index closing June up 56% at 4376.26, the oil & gas index up 94% at 3652.13
and the mining index up 97% at 4315.59. The CDNX Index reached an all-time high of 4471.84
on March 20.
Average trading volume for the period was 24,474 trades per day,
peaking at 66,751 trades on March 6. Average trading value was $97.6 million per day,
reaching a daily high of $169.9 million on March 7.
Of the 79 new companies listed during the first half of the year, 53
were capital pool companies. There were 11 reverse take-overs during the same period.
Total listings as of June 30 stood at 2,269.
June Results
For the month of June, CDNX recorded a decrease in
trading activity compared to the previous month. The volume of shares traded declined from
877 million shares in May to 849 million shares, off 3 per cent. However, the value of
shares traded rose by 5 per cent, totaling $842 million for June. The CDNX Index close at
3458.67 on June 30 showed an increase of 6 per cent over May. The technology index rose 9 per cent in
June, while the mining index gained 10 per cent and the oil & gas index added 6 per
cent. The total market capitalization for non-TSE interlisted securities as of June 30 was
$22.2 billion.
There were sixteen new listings during June,
including: Intermedia Capital Corp.; WCC Services Inc.; Synx Pharma Inc.; European
Goldfields Limited; WWS Capital Inc.; Sonomax Hearing Healthcare Inc.; Planex Ventures
Ltd.; Medici Mineral Inc.; East Side Capital Inc.; Microtec Corporation; Porpoise Capital
Network Inc.; Computer Modelling Group Ltd.; Destiny Hospitality Ltd.; Head4 Solutions
Inc.; Emercap Ventures Inc.; and, Flukong Enterprise Inc. Additionally, there were three
reverse take-overs (RTO) in June: Dynasty Motorcar Corporation; IP Applications Corp.;
and, QHR Technologies Inc.
